ELECTRICAL PARKING BRAKE DEVICE
An electrical parking brake device includes an operation switch and a control circuit. The operation switch includes a switch button, miniature switches, operation switch terminals and inside conductors, the switch button being in one of an On state, an Off state and a neutral state, the miniature switches operating in conjunction with the state of the switch button. The control circuit includes control circuit terminals, a switch verification circuit, management circuitry and brake application command circuitry, the management circuitry managing the electrical parking brake device. The operation switch defines closed circuits that are independent in terms of a pair of the operation switch terminals, for each of the operating states. The closed circuits are closed circuits that, when one or more of the miniature switches fail, avoids influence of the failure, by the miniature switches other than the one or more failing miniature switches.
SAFETY CIRCUIT FOR AN ELEVATOR SYSTEM
A safety circuit for an elevator system includes a first circuit having a plurality of switching contacts and a second circuit having a plurality of switching contacts. The switching contacts of the first circuit are connected in series, and the switching contacts of the second circuit are connected in parallel. Each switching contact of the first circuit is associated with a different switching contact of the second circuit. The switching contacts that are associated with each other are in opposite switching states.
Button structure
A button structure comprises a base layer, a supporting structure arranged on the base layer, an elastic film layer, the elastic film layer covering the support structure and connected to the support structure, the support structure and the elastic film layer defining a cavity above the base layer, a first upper electrode arranged on the lower surface of the elastic film layer and located in the cavity, a first lower electrode, arranged on the base layer and located in the cavity, and a first variable resistance elastic body between the first upper and first lower electrodes, either arranged on the lower surface of the first upper electrode or arranged on the upper surface of the first lower electrode. When the elastic film layer is elastically deformed in the direction of the base layer, the first variable resistance elastic body connects the first upper electrode with the first lower electrode so as to generate a first signal related to the elastic deformation of the first variable resistance elastic body.
